Today's Scripture

Romans 8:6
"The mind governed by the Spirit is life and peace."

Devotional

Your thoughts are never neutral. They are always leading you somewhere. If your mind is focused on fear, worry, or worst-case scenarios, it will pull you down a path that produces anxiety and instability. But when your thoughts are governed by the Spirit, they produce life and peace, even when circumstances have not changed.

Every day, you are carrying a picture in your mind. That picture may come from what you see around you, what you’ve experienced, or what you’ve been told. But you have a choice. You can allow that picture to be shaped by your circumstances, or you can intentionally replace it with what God says.

This requires being proactive. You cannot passively allow thoughts to run unchecked. When a negative image begins to form, you have to stop it and replace it with truth. That means deliberately choosing to think differently, even when it feels unnatural at first.

Over time, the picture you carry will become stronger than what you see. And when that happens, your thoughts will begin producing peace instead of pressure.
